What is a Client Support Portal?
A client support portal is a secure and private online platform that enables seamless communication and collaboration between clients and service providers. It serves as a centralized hub where clients can access resources, communicate with their service providers, schedule appointments, and more.
By providing a dedicated space for client-provider interactions, a client support portal streamlines the client care process and enhances the overall service experience. Through this portal, clients can securely engage with their service providers, access relevant documents and resources, and stay informed about upcoming appointments or important updates.

Key Features of an Effective Client Support Portal
To provide optimal support and care for clients, an effective client support portal should possess key features that enhance communication, organization, and accessibility. Here are three essential features to consider when implementing a client support portal:
Secure and Private Communication
Maintaining secure and private communication channels is crucial for client confidentiality and trust. A robust client support portal should offer encrypted messaging capabilities, ensuring that sensitive information remains protected. By providing a secure space for clients to communicate with their therapist, practitioner, coach, or psychologist, it fosters a sense of safety and confidentiality.
In addition to secure messaging, a client support portal should allow clients to securely exchange files and documents. Appointment Scheduling and Reminders
Efficient appointment scheduling is a critical aspect of client care. A client support portal should offer a user-friendly interface that allows clients to schedule appointments directly within the portal. This feature streamlines the process, eliminating the need for back-and-forth communication and phone calls.
To ensure that clients never miss an appointment, the portal should also provide automated reminders. These reminders can be sent via email or SMS, helping clients stay organized and reducing the likelihood of missed sessions. By incorporating appointment scheduling and reminders within the client support portal, both therapists and clients can manage their schedules more effectively.
Access to Resources and Documents
A comprehensive client support portal should offer easy access to relevant resources and documents. This feature allows therapists, practitioners, coaches, or psychologists to share educational materials, exercises, worksheets, or treatment plans with their clients. By providing a centralized location for these resources, clients can conveniently access and review them at any time.
Furthermore, the portal should enable clients to upload documents or forms securely. This capability facilitates seamless collaboration and ensures that all necessary information is readily available to both the client and the therapist. Setting Up and Customizing the Portal
Once you’ve chosen a platform, it’s time to set up and customize your client support portal. Start by configuring the portal’s settings, such as privacy settings, access levels, and permissions. This ensures that you have control over which information and resources are available to your clients.
Customization is key to creating a branded and user-friendly experience for your clients. Personalize the portal by adding your logo, choosing color schemes that align with your brand, and creating a user-friendly layout. Consider organizing the portal in a way that makes it easy for clients to navigate and find what they need.

Training and Onboarding Clients
To ensure a smooth transition to the client support portal, it’s important to provide training and onboarding for your clients. Create user guides or video tutorials that explain how to navigate the portal, access resources, and communicate with you through the platform. Offer personalized support and be available to answer any questions or concerns your clients may have.
Consider hosting a training session or webinar to walk your clients through the portal’s features and functionalities. This allows them to become familiar with the platform and utilize its capabilities effectively. Encourage feedback and address any challenges or issues that may arise during the onboarding process.
By investing time and effort into training and onboarding, you can ensure that your clients feel confident and comfortable using the client support portal. This will ultimately lead to increased client satisfaction and improved client care.
